参考 > 函数参考 > 文本函数 > JSONDeleteElement
 
JSONDeleteElement
目的 
删除由对象名、数组索引或路径指定的 JSON 数据元素。
格式 
JSONDeleteElement ( json ; 键或索引或路径 )
参数 
json - 包含 JSON 对象或数组的文本表达式或字段。
键或索引或路径 - 指定 JSON 对象名(键)、数组索引或路径的文本表达式或字段。请参阅使用 JSON 函数
返回的数据类型 
文本
源于 
FileMaker Pro 16.0
注释 
Runtime 解决方案不支持此函数,会返回“?”。
示例 1 
从 JSON 对象删除一个元素。
JSONDeleteElement ( "{ \"a\" : 11 , \"b\" : 12 , \"c\" : 13 }" ; "b" ) 返回“{"a":11,"c":13}”。
示例 2 
从嵌套 JSON 对象删除一个元素。如果 $$JSON 变量设置为
{
   "a" :
   {
      "id" : 12,
      "lnk" : false
   }
}
JSONFormatElements (
   JSONDeleteElement ( $$JSON ; "a.lnk" )
)
返回
{
"a" :
{
"id" : 12
}
}
相关主题 
函数参考(类别列表)
函数参考(按字母数字顺序排序的列表)
关于公式
关于函数
定义计算字段
在公式中使用运算符
使用 JSON 函数